How to Reach Schattendorf in Austria

Schattendorf is a charming village located in the beautiful country of Austria. Situated in the state of Burgenland, it offers a tranquil escape for visitors seeking to explore the region's natural beauty and rich cultural heritage. Here are some ways to reach Schattendorf:

By Air:

If you are traveling from abroad, the nearest international airport to Schattendorf is Vienna International Airport. From there, you can take a direct train or rent a car to reach the village. The journey takes approximately 1.5 hours by car or 2 hours by train.

By Train:

Schattendorf has its own train station, making it easily accessible by rail. You can take a train from Vienna or any major city in Austria to reach the village. The train ride offers picturesque views of the Austrian countryside, allowing you to immerse yourself in the scenic beauty along the way.

By Car:

If you prefer to drive, Schattendorf is conveniently located near major highways. From Vienna, you can follow the A3 and A4 highways, heading south towards Eisenstadt. From there, take the B50 road towards Schattendorf. The journey takes approximately 1 hour, depending on traffic conditions.

By Bus:

Another option to reach Schattendorf is by bus. There are regular bus services connecting the village with nearby towns and cities. You can check the local bus schedules and plan your journey accordingly.

By Bicycle:

For the adventure enthusiasts, cycling to Schattendorf can be a rewarding experience. The village is well-connected to the regional cycling routes, allowing you to enjoy the scenic landscapes while pedaling your way to the destination.

Getting to know Schattendorf

Schattendorf is a charming village located in Austria. Situated in the Eisenstadt-Umgebung District, it is nestled in the beautiful Burgenland region. This tranquil village is known for its picturesque landscapes, rich history, and warm hospitality.

One of the notable features of Schattendorf is its stunning natural surroundings. The village is surrounded by lush green fields, rolling hills, and dense forests, creating a breathtaking backdrop. These natural landscapes offer plenty of opportunities for outdoor activities such as hiking, cycling, and nature walks. Visitors can explore the scenic trails that lead to hidden gems and enjoy the serenity of the countryside.
